2.1 Data collected on the kodo.sn website

Contact and application forms. The kodo.sn site offers several forms (user waitlist, Ambassador application, Partner application, Investor inquiry). Depending on the form submitted, we collect: your name, phone number and/or email address, country, and, where applicable, your company or fund name, your role, and any free-text message you choose to send us. This information is used solely to respond to your request and, if you consent at the time of submission, to follow up with you regarding the relevant program.

Attribution data. When you submit one of these forms, we also record the page you navigated from, the page that referred you to the site (if any), and the campaign parameters present in the URL (utm_source, utm_medium, utm_campaign). This data helps us understand which channels bring visitors to the site; it is not cross-referenced with your identity beyond the form you submitted.

Redirection to WhatsApp. Some buttons on the site open a WhatsApp conversation with the Kodo team. When you click one of these buttons, we record the event (originating page, timestamp) before WhatsApp opens, but we do not have access to the content of your WhatsApp exchanges. WhatsApp is a service operated by Meta; its use is governed by WhatsApp's own privacy policy, independent of this Policy.

Cookies and analytics. We use PostHog to measure site traffic (pages viewed, buttons clicked, forms submitted). See Section 11 for details on the cookies used and how to disable them.

7. Data retention periods

7.1 Data collected via the website (forms)

Information submitted via a form on the site (waitlist, Ambassador application, Partner application, Investor inquiry) is retained for 24 months from your last interaction with us, unless you request its deletion before this period or your application results in the creation of a Kodo account, in which case the rules in section 7.2 apply from that point.

7.2 Active data

As long as your Kodo account is active, your personal data is retained to enable the provision of services and management of your account.

7.3 Data after account closure

After your Kodo account is closed, we retain:

Type of dataRetention period
Transaction data12 months after account closure
Contact data (phone number, email)12 months after account closure
Security data (login logs, incidents)12 months after account closure
Customer support data12 months after the request is closed
Legal and accounting dataAs required by applicable legal obligations (generally 5 to 10 years)

7.4 Anonymized data

Beyond the retention periods above, your data may be anonymized (so that it is no longer possible to identify you) and retained for statistical purposes and to improve our services, with no time limit.

7.5 Kodo Points data

Kodo Points and their associated history are deleted when the account is closed. They cannot be recovered after closure.

9. Your rights over your data

In accordance with applicable regulations, you have the following rights regarding your personal data:

9.1 Right to information

You have the right to be informed of how your data is collected and used. This Privacy Policy fulfills that purpose.

9.2 Right of access

You can request a copy of all the personal data we hold about you, as well as information about its processing (purposes, retention period, recipients, etc.).

9.3 Right to rectification

If your personal data is inaccurate, incomplete, or outdated, you can request that it be corrected or updated at any time.

9.4 Right to erasure ("right to be forgotten")

You can request the deletion of your personal data in cases provided for by law:

  • The data is no longer necessary for the purposes for which it was collected
  • You withdraw your consent and there is no other legal basis
  • You object to the processing and there is no overriding legitimate ground

This right does not apply where retention is necessary to comply with a legal obligation or to defend legal rights.

9.5 Right to restriction of processing

In certain cases (contesting the accuracy of the data, unlawful processing, data needed for a dispute), you can request that the processing of your data be restricted.

9.6 Right to data portability

You can request to receive your data in a structured, commonly used, machine-readable format, so you can transmit it to another provider.

9.7 Right to object

You can object to the processing of your data for direct marketing purposes (including any related profiling). You can also object to processing based on legitimate interest for reasons relating to your particular situation.

9.8 Right to withdraw consent

Where processing of your data is based on your consent, you can withdraw it at any time. Withdrawing consent does not affect the lawfulness of processing carried out before the withdrawal.

11. Cookies and tracking technologies

11.1 What is a cookie?

A cookie is a small text file placed on your device when you access the Kodo platform. It allows the platform to recognize your device on future visits and improve your experience.

11.2 Cookies used on kodo.sn

  • Analytics cookies (PostHog): allow us to understand how you use the site (pages visited, buttons clicked, forms submitted) so we can improve it. Placed as soon as you arrive on the site.

Once available, the Kodo app may use cookies or equivalent technologies strictly necessary for authenticating and securing your session; this Policy will be updated accordingly if and when that happens.

11.3 Managing cookies

You can disable analytics cookies at any time via your browser settings (blocking third-party cookies, tracker-blocking extensions). Refusing analytics cookies does not affect your ability to browse the site or submit a form.
